猿代码 — 科研/AI模型/高性能计算
0

"超级计算机性能提升秘籍:GPU加速技巧揭秘"

摘要: 超级计算机一直在不断追求性能的提升,GPU加速技术已成为提高超级计算机性能的重要方式。本文将揭秘GPU加速技巧,帮助读者更好地了解和利用GPU加速技术。GPU加速技术是利用图形处理器的并行计算能力来加速各种计算任 ...
超级计算机一直在不断追求性能的提升,GPU加速技术已成为提高超级计算机性能的重要方式。本文将揭秘GPU加速技巧,帮助读者更好地了解和利用GPU加速技术。

GPU加速技术是利用图形处理器的并行计算能力来加速各种计算任务,包括科学计算、数据分析、人工智能等领域。GPU相比CPU拥有更多的核心和更高的计算能力,能够在同样的时间内处理更多的计算任务。

要充分发挥GPU的加速性能,首先需要了解并利用好GPU编程模型。目前主流的GPU编程模型包括CUDA和OpenCL,开发者可以根据自己的需求选择合适的GPU编程模型进行开发。

另外,合理设计GPU加速算法也是提高性能的关键。通过减少数据传输、优化计算流程、降低内存占用等方式,可以有效提升GPU加速算法的性能。

并行计算是GPU加速技术的核心,充分利用GPU的并行计算能力可以大大提高计算效率。开发者可以通过并行计算框架和并行算法来充分发挥GPU的并行计算能力。

除了硬件和算法优化,优化GPU加速技术的关键还在于对数据的管理和传输。通过减少数据的拷贝和移动,可以有效减少GPU加速过程中的IO消耗,提高计算效率。

总的来说,充分发挥GPU加速技术的性能需要全方位的优化,包括硬件、算法、数据管理等方面。只有综合考虑各个方面的因素,才能真正实现GPU加速技术的性能提升。希望本文对读者在GPU加速技术方面有所帮助,谢谢。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-21 10:50
  • 0
    粉丝
  • 106
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)